Quoting srbmod (Reply 2):
I also wonder if PHL or PIT would ever consider them down the road if the number of machines as well as licenses were to be raised?

At present, PA's current casino legislation (passed in 2004) prohibits the situating of 2 or more casinos within 10 miles of each other unless they're are located in the same county (which allows the SugarHouse Casino (presently under construction) and the proposed Foxwoods Casino to be situated in Philadelphia).

Harrah's being situated in Chester (located in Delaware County about 6 to 7 miles from PHL) prevents placing a casino (even if it's just slots in the terminals) at or near PHL.
